Airman in the U.S. Air Force originally assigned to Icarus Base, now aboard the Ancient deep-space exploratory vessel Destiny.

Dunning serves under the command of Colonel Everett Young.

DETAILS

PLAYED BY: Darcy Laurie
FIRST APPEARED: Space

KEY EPISODES

Space - Airman Dunning is in a corridor with Chloe when hostile aliens cut into Destiny and abduct her.
Divided - Caught on the civilian's side of the line when they take over the ship, Dunning raises his weapon against them but is calmed by T.J.
Faith - Dunning joins Lt. Scott's team to live on an idyllic alien world for several weeks, where he has a minor scuffle with a civilian over who will dig the latrine.
Pain - Affected by an alien tick, Dunning hallucinates that he has snakes under his skin.
Aftermath - Dunning joins a failed shuttle mission to retrieve supplies from a planet, and helps the other crash survivors unbury the Stargate after the shuttle is wrecked.
Pathogen - While on board an Ancient seed ship Dunning is rendered unconscious when an alien shoots him in the back with a stun weapon.
